Vantage Energy Management software saves homeowners energy

“There is a lot of hype today around ‘green,’ but from its inception 25 years ago, Vantage has been a pioneer in intelligent control solutions that have provided and managed energy efficiency,” says Vantage vice president of marketing Andrew Wale.

“The Energy Management Solution is a natural evolution to our systems. We’re now offering home-owners the ability to see real-time energy usage and the effect of strategies that manage energy usage in accordance with their own lifestyle requirements.”

The Energy Management Solution includes the following:
• Software that is easily uploaded to the Vantage InFusion System.
• A separate power meter quickly installed by the dealer.
• New ranges of occupancy and ambient light level sensors.
• Both wired and wireless interfaces for integrated control of Somfy automated window treatments.

The system can also be programmed by the dealer with local power costs so that the home-owner can instantly view the exact kilowatt hours they are saving, as well as the equivalent dollar savings.

Additionally, the Energy Management Solution is based on a global platform, making it compatible with any utility company, anywhere around the world—a key differentiator for the luxury market. This flexibility, coupled with the pre-programmed software, makes the Energy Management Solution a simple upgrade for the home-owner and an effortless installation for the dealer.

Home-owners who have the product installed reported a 20% decrease in lighting energy usage from dimming alone since implementing the system. This decrease could contribute to the positive effects of energy conservation on the environment as a whole.

Projected annual percentage savings from the Vantage Energy Management Solution:

Measurement and real-time feedback 5 – 15%
Lighting (motion sensing and dimming) 5 – 10%
Shade control 5 – 15%
HVAC control 5 – 15%

The Energy Management Solution can be locally programmed with any of eight pre-set strategies proven to save energy. These strategies, available at the touch of a button, are set to dim lights, adjust temperature and turn off appliances according to a timed schedule or in response to motion detectors.

The Energy Management Solution also delivers up-to-date weather, with outdoor temperature and weather conditions, and offers three to five day forecasts.

The system will begin shipping in June.
